Specialty training in Orthopaedic Oncology (July 2005 – May 2007):

I worked as a clinical fellow in Orthopaedic oncology service – Tata Memorial Hospital – Mumbai, India. My

consultants were Dr. Ajay Puri and Dr. M.G.Agarwal. Under their guidance, I gained valuable experience in

management of bone and soft tissue tumors. I was involved in more then 500 tumor surgeries in those 22

months since my appointment as a fellow either as an assistant or as primary surgeon. I have learnt

concepts of megaprosthetic reconstructions around knee, shoulder and hip. I am now experienced in using

customized endoprosthesis including imported systems like GMRS, Stanmore implants and ISIQU. I was

also exposed to variety of intercalary resections of long bones and reconstructions using allografts or

biological methods like vascularised fibula & tibialisation of fibula. I assisted/did arthrodesis at knee, ankle

and wrist for variety of disorders. I was fortunate to assist in pelvic surgeries including internal and external

hemipelvectomies and sacral resections and curettage, as it was being quite commonly done at Tata

Hospital. I am familiar with rotationplasties as I have witnessed more then 20 rotationplasties. I have

gained valuable experience in treatment of GCTs. I also got experience in treatment of skeletal metastasis

and extremity soft tissue sarcomas. I have performed many percutaneous, CT guided and open biopsies.

Tata Memorial Hospital is a high volume center and on an average, we used to see around 150 patients

(including new patients, references and follow up) in OPD every week. As a fellow, my duties also included

video assisted counseling of the patients undergoing surgery and to discuss possible complications, future

consequences and financial aspects. I had also been looking after data collection, updating follow up

details, maintaining audits and coordinating ongoing prospective rendomised trials in the service.

Assistant Professor at GCRI (May 2007 – June 2014)

Since May 2007, I have been working as Assistant Professor at Gujarat Cancer & Research Institute (GCRI),

in Orthopaedic Oncology service. GCRI is situated in Ahmedabad city. It is the largest regional cancer center

for the state of Gujarat. It is a 600 bedded dedicated cancer hospital and is a part of Government civil

hospital which is the biggest hospital of Asia. GCRI is a high volume center and I am practicing and

implementing the concepts which I have learnt at Tata Memorial Hospital. During these 7 years, I

performed more than 1200 major surgeries in the department including variety of limb conservation,

ablative and palliative surgeries.
